Synopsis "Ademolus Classification of hypoglycemia in Diabetes Management (in English)"

The book focused majorly on the classification of hypoglycemia as it relates to diabetes in diverse ways/angle. Chapter 1 gave a general overview of the distribution of diabetes worldwide followed by an anatomical and physiological review that serves as background knowledge. It describes what the classification is about with some historical facts. I further discussed the focus on the hypoglycemia classification in diabetes as viewed from the angle of type 1 Diabetes mellitus (DM), type 2 DM, drugs used to treat DM, gestational diabetes complicated by hypoglycemia, endocrine disruptors causing hypoglycemia and how it relates to diabetes, bariatric surgery, sports medicine and how it affects people living with diabetes, and from the angle of technological advancement in medical practice as it relates to diabetes-telehealth, telemedicine. It gives a balanced understanding to the reader on the usefulness of Ademolus Classification of Hypoglycemia in our contemporary time. The targeted multidisciplinary audience includes medical students, medical postgraduate students, diabetologist, endocrinologist, paramedics, nurses and their instructors, pharmacist and the general public.
